Lokalisierung von ASP.NET MVC-Websites mit GNU Gettext?
-
22-08-2019 - |
Frage
Dies könnte eine ungewöhnliche Frage, aber gibt es einen Rahmen oder zumindest einige Hilfsklassen, die mich zum Lokalisieren von einer C # ASP.NET MVC Website verwenden GNU Gettext helfen würde? Ich habe Gettext in einer früheren (verwalteten Code) Projekt mit und schätzen die Möglichkeit PoEdit zu verwenden, um die Ressourcen für die Übersetzung.
Ich denke, das würde bedeuten, ein paar Htmlhelper-Erweiterungsmethoden Codierung, die die Ressourcen-Strings aus Gettext extrahieren kann. Es scheint sogar eine Art von C # gettext Wrapper zu sein, aber ich war nicht in der Lage ein Handbuch oder Tutorial zu finden. Alle Zeiger würden sehr geschätzt werden.
Danke,
Adrian
Lösung
FairlyLocal ist auch schön. Ich änderte es um meine eigenen Bedürfnisse und bin ziemlich glücklich mit dem, was sie angeboten:
Andere Tipps
Die Mono-Projekt-Website hat ein Tutorial wie gettext in einer C # Anwendung zu verwenden.
Auch in diesem Beitrag deckt den spezifischen Gegenstand dieser Frage, obwohl es nicht klar macht, wie es den Katalog in Managed-Land erhält: http://weblogs.manas.com.ar/spalladino/2009/ 01.10 / using-Gnu-gettext-for-i18n-in-c-und-asp-net /